  5. You can deploy a Sharepoint site - the only issue I've found is that it can take up to 2 hours to kick in on a new login... So fine for staff, less so for pupils using a different device each time. User Config > Policies > Administrative Templates > Onedrive > Configure team site libraries to sync automatically Stick the library ID in there and away you go. (full guide here: https://www.blackforce.co.uk/2019/06/07/automatically-sync-microsoft-sharepoint-team-site-libraries-now-live) As psydii said, I'd definitely avoid running onedrive on a machine and allowing others to map to that instance - if it signs out for any reason (updates etc), you're going to have issues!

  22. The way I do it is: Install Anti-spam module and enable mail relay. Create a 365 account to be used for reports (I use smoothwall@domain) Go to Reports > Settings > Output Settings Set SMTP Server to 127.0.0.1, senders email address to [email protected] Leave SMTP Auth & TLS unchecked, and add your 365 credentials in. Save, then test Go to Reports > Settings > Groups and create a group with the email addresses you want to receive the report, then choose this group when creating your reports.
